How We Help
Thru the chair is an initiative founded with the ideology of contributing significantly towards solving the current educational challenges in Southern Africa. The initiative aims to expose 1000 unique individuals by telling 1000 visual stories through 1000 reinvented chairs which will be auctioned to Chair of boards resulting in 1000 opportunities to make a difference.
- Promote storytelling and design thinking to solve problems
- Communicating constructively to unite people and bring about change
- Activating individuals and groups to illicit empathy and action within our communities
- Providing a platform to raise funds to solve the education needs in Southern Africa

Thru The Chair collaborated with the Inscape students at their Cape Town, Durban, Midrand, and Pretoria campuses. The students were the first group of individuals to take part in a Thru the Chair event. The students collected over 600 old broken chairs and in March 2018 over a couple of days, the students engaged in storytelling workshops where they learnt how to craft a meaningful story about themselves, shared this with their peers and in the process learnt about each other. The ‘workshop’ provoked empathy for one another and a unifying of a diverse student body. The developed stories were then applied to the old broken chairs in the process of reinventing the good for nothing chairs that had been collected.
We are proud to exhibit the top reinvented chairs that have been selected to be auctioned at charity events in November 2018 by Thru The Chair. Influential people have been invited to ‘take a seat around the table of education’ and contribute towards making a difference in our country by participating in the auctions. Target prices have been noted as an indication of how much we wish to raise to effect our highlighted beneficiaries that include tertiary scholarship students and improvements for community schools.
We thank the students who have exposed themselves through their own personal stories to contribute to the betterment of others and our country.

Our Partners
Thru the chair has sought out strategic partnerships that will best align with the vision, mission, and objectives of the NPC. The success of the initiative requires winning alliances who will make a meaningful difference and ensure genuine change.
Thru the chair and its partners believe in the importance of education as a vital tool for securing the future prosperity of communities and for the long-term sustainability and success of our country.







Belgotex
Belgotex designs, manufacture and delivers quality floors that endure the speed of life. The company has, over the last 35 years, built a reputation as sustainable pioneers in flooring solutions, by innovation far beyond the product itself.
Involvement in the project: Sponsored the ‘Re-invent A Chair workshop’ and pledged a contribution that will go towards bursaries for young, aspiring designers needing financial aid to complete a course at Inscape.

Decorex
Decorex SA, South Africa’s premier décor, design and lifestyle exhibition showcases in three cities – Durban, Cape Town and Johannesburg. The décor and design industry’s leading and most trusted brand was founded in 1994 and continues to play a pivitol role in shaping the industry.
Involvement in the project: Decorex has committed to sponsoring a generous sized exhibition space at this years show. They have also assisted by promoting with their marketing platforms as well as directing other exhibitors towards the brand. Decorex have pledged to be a partner with Thru The Chair for the next three years and helping to grow awareness of the brand through exhibiting at the shows. The aim is to have the Thru The Chair exhibits in all three cities by next year.

Inscape
Inscape was established in 1981 as the first creative and multi-disciplinary design institution in South Africa. We specialize in the creative and design industries, built environment, business and communication, and digital technology-driven education offering expert integration to that end. We place great emphasis on our people and their personal development within the microcosm. Our core values; Quality, Authenticity, and Relationships drive us to grow, improve and make a difference in everything we do. The organization has experienced significant growth since its inception and now extends its ethos and offering internationally.
Involvement in the project: Inscape students at the Cape Town, Durban, Midrand and Pretoria campuses were the first group of individuals to take part in a Thru the Chair event. The students collected over 600 old broken chairs and engaged in storytelling workshops where they learnt how to craft a meaningful story about themselves. The developed stories were then applied to the old broken chairs in the process of reinventing them.
